Members of Parliament Retiring Allowances Act

Marginal note:1992, c. 46, s. 81; 2001, c. 20, s. 14(1)
  •  (1) The definitions “annual allowance” and “salary” in subsection 2(1) of the Members of Parliament Retiring Allowances Act are replaced by the following:

    “annual allowance”

    « indemnité annuelle »

    “annual allowance” means an annual allowance payable to a member pursuant to section 62 or 62.3 of the Parliament of Canada Act or payable to a member pursuant to an appropriation Act as Deputy Chairman or Assistant Deputy Chairman of a committee;

    “salary”

    « traitement »

    “salary” means a salary payable to a member pursuant to section 4 or 4.1 of the Salaries Act or section 60, 61, 62.1 or 62.2 of the Parliament of Canada Act, or payable to a member pursuant to an appropriation Act as a minister of state or a minister without portfolio;

  • Marginal note:1992, c. 46, s. 81

    (2) Paragraph (c) of the definition “sessional indemnity” in subsection 2(1) of the Act is replaced by the following:

    • (c) in relation to a period after July 7, 1974, the allowance payable to a member under section 55 or 55.1 of the Parliament of Canada Act;

Referendum Act

 Subsection 5(1) of the Referendum Act is replaced by the following:

Marginal note:Motion for approval of referendum question
  • 5. (1) Subject to subsections (2) and (4), a member of the Queen’s Privy Council for Canada referred to in section 4.1 of the Salaries Act may, in accordance with the procedures of the House of Commons, give notice of a motion for the approval of the text of a referendum question.
